The Carolina Hurricanes continue to prove the doubters wrong as after 18 games, they sit alone atop the Metropolitan Division.
Even with injuries to Frederik Andersen and Seth Jarvis, the Canes are still finding a way.
Following a 4-1 win over the Philadelphia Flyers last night, the Canes moved ahead of the idle Washington Capitals and New Jersey Devils.
Funny enough, the Devils are now the Hurricanes' next opponent as they try to spoil both their three-game win streak as well as perfect 6-0-0 Metro division record.
New Jersey has been sitting for a while after a 4-0 shutout loss to the Tampa Bay Lightning on Saturday, but before that they had beaten the Florida Panthers twice on the road (also lost 1-0 to San Jose at home before that).
After a disappointing season last year, the Devils appear to be back on their feet a bit as they rank in the top 10 for goals per game, goals against per game and both power play and penalty kill.
Jacob Markstrom and Jake Allen have also both brought stability to the net, something New Jersey has notably lacked.
It should be a hard-fought battle between two top teams, but it will also be a fight between a very well rested team and a potentially tired squad.
